- [ ] Key ceremony step 7: Websocket compression review (Plugfest SDK)

Hey plugin folks — before we mint the new signing keys for the Burrowlink plugin channel, make sure you've read the note on websocket compression tradeoffs. permessage-deflate saves bandwidth but burns CPU on small frames, so the SDK defaults it off; flip it on only for chatty, payload-heavy plugins. Confirm your manifest declares your choice, since it's baked into the signed bundle. When you're set, unseal the signing envelope using the recovery passphrase below.

vault phrase of tawig-taduf = zorath-oliwyn

Subject: Churn — Ostler Pilot

Heads of department: churn in the Ostler pilot reached 11% in February, double forecast. Exit interviews cite setup friction and weak reporting features. Priya's team ships a fix on the 20th. Hold all pilot marketing spend until retention stabilises. Weekly dashboards start Monday; attendance at Thursday's review is mandatory. Decision on pilot extension comes at month end. Context that must stay internal follows in the confidential note below.

board note of tadup-tajog: Headcount on the Oliiel team goes from 31 to 88 by the end of February. Gross margin on Oliiel came in at 62 percent against a plan of 29 percent.

// MIGRATION NOTE — Hermetic build cutover (Project Kilnworks)
// This constant pins the toolchain snapshot used by the sealed
// builders. Under the old Fernbrook CI, network fetches happened
// at compile time, so reviewers could not reproduce artifacts
// byte-for-byte. The hermetic pipeline forbids ambient network
// and filesystem access; all inputs are declared here. Do not
// bump this without re-running the reproducibility audit.
// For verification, compare your local output against the token
// recorded below.

build token for yajof-bajof: htk31_506ff1188f74596b5bb2eec94edc43c

Minutes – Management Meeting, Fenwright Tools

Welcome aboard! Quick recap for our incoming director: we agreed to shift Orbita subscriptions to annual billing from Q3. Marta flagged churn risk among smaller accounts; Deyan will draft a discount ladder to soften the move. Finance expects smoother cash flow by winter. One item stayed off the main agenda and is noted below.

board note of yadup-fajef: Druiusox Holdings is in early talks to buy Norwynek Systems for about $186.0 million. The Kaseth launch date is June 24, and nothing goes to the press before then. Legal wants the Quenethek Group term sheet withdrawn before November 27.